Joseph Homsany is the president of Patronato de Nutrición (Nutrition Board), a non-profit organization that was created 16 years ago by a group of concerned private investors in Panama. Patronato de Nutrición recognized the malnutrition problem throughout the remote areas of Panama. The board’s mission is to educate rural communities in order for them to organize themselves into farm cooperatives, thus becoming nutritionally and economically independent. The Patronato operates with the help of private donations and volunteers.

Farm sponsors provide the funds needed to start the farm and provide education. The community benefiting from the farm must take care of it, and the Patronato organizes a board of directors. The farmland is owned by the Patronato at first and remains so until the community passes inspection after a probation period. This period can last up to three years. Thereafter, the land title is turned over to the board of directors of the farm, thus becoming the community’s farm and not just one individual’s.

With the proper management of this program, over 33,000 Panamanians live with dignity and pride in 340 communities located in remote areas throughout Panama. On our own, we have also replanted 1,800 hectares (4,448 acres) of teak trees. This provides us with a number of encouraging results. First, we have a reforestation program in place, and our company, Inversiones Hope, S.A. is the managing company that oversees the entire program. It offers a product that is becoming increasingly difficult to find. We replant and manage the growth of the trees. The Government of Panama has a residency visa available for those who invest in Panama by establishing a registered reforestation project such as Inversiones Hope, S.A. has done.

We have also invested in purchasing 840 hectares (2,076 acres) of rainforest. It is just that: virgin rainforest! We intend to maintain these forests in their natural state just as we received them. In time, we hope to make them available to those who love to see nature as it is intended to be.
